Position Overview

We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Payroll Administrator to join our team. This entry-level role is ideal for someone with strong problem-solving abilities who thrives in a fast-paced environment. You will be responsible for processing accurate and timely payroll for employees across multiple locations while ensuring compliance with all applicable regulations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ist with semi-monthly and monthly payroll cycles for employees across multiple locations
  • Verify records, hours worked, and paid time off for accuracy
  • Verifying  wages, deductions, bonuses, and other pay adjustments
  • Research and resolve payroll discrepancies and employee inquiries in a timely manner
  • Maintain employee payroll records and ensure data integrity in the payroll system
  • Coordinate with HR and other departments to process new hires, terminations, and status changes
  • Ensure compliance with all global entities and local payroll regulations across different jurisdictions
  • Generate payroll reports for management review and auditing purposes
  • Review and verify benefit charges and bills
  • Assist with employee questions regarding benefits and payroll
  • Assist with year-end processing, 
  • Assist with Month end reconciliation
